MAE graduates will be needed in the private sector, the public sector, and international/nonprofit organizations. Here are some of the positions and types of institutions that an MAE graduate could look forward to after graduation:

 

Positions

Analyst: Financial, Policy, Management, Legislative, Credit, Budget, Investment
Management Consultant
Research Associate/Director
City Planner
Financial Planner
Central Bank Economist
Strategist
Financial Director/Manager
Treasury Specialist
Senior Manager
Teacher/Professor
Economic Researcher
Government Staff Economist

Institutions

Companies and Corporations in various industries
Think tanks
World Bank
International Monetary Fund
U.S. Bureau of Labor Statistics
Organization for Economic Co-operation and Development
Industrial associations
Trade associations
Governmental committees
